Basic Elements of a Plumbing System


Pipes and Tubes


At the heart of your pipes system are the pipes and tubes that bring water throughout your home. These can be made of numerous products such as copper, PVC, or PEX, each with its benefits in terms of resilience and cost-effectiveness.

Components: Sinks, Toilets, Showers, and so on.


Fixtures like sinks, commodes, showers, and tubs are where water is used in your house. Comprehending just how these components connect to the plumbing system aids in identifying problems and intending upgrades.

Valves and Shut-off Factors


Valves manage the circulation of water in your plumbing system. Shut-off valves are vital during emergencies or when you need to make repair services, allowing you to separate parts of the system without disrupting water circulation to the entire home.

Water Supply System


Key Water Line


The main water line attaches your home to the municipal water or a private well. It's where water enters your home and is distributed to numerous fixtures.

Water Meter and Stress Regulator


The water meter procedures your water usage, while a pressure regulator makes certain that water flows at a secure pressure throughout your home's plumbing system, stopping damage to pipelines and fixtures.

Cold Water vs. Warm water Lines


Understanding the difference in between cold water lines, which supply water directly from the primary, and warm water lines, which carry heated water from the hot water heater, helps in troubleshooting and planning for upgrades.

Drain System


Drain Pipeline and Traps


Drain pipes bring wastewater far from sinks, showers, and toilets to the sewage system or septic tank. Traps stop sewage system gases from entering your home and also trap debris that can cause obstructions.

Ventilation Pipes


Ventilation pipelines permit air right into the drainage system, avoiding suction that might reduce water drainage and trigger traps to empty. Proper air flow is crucial for preserving the integrity of your pipes system.

Relevance of Appropriate Drainage


Ensuring appropriate drainage protects against backups and water damages. On a regular basis cleaning drains and maintaining traps can prevent costly repair work and extend the life of your plumbing system.

Water Heating System


Types of Water Heaters


Hot water heater can be tankless or typical tank-style. Tankless heaters heat water on demand, while containers keep heated water for instant usage.

Exactly How Water Heaters Link to the Pipes System


Comprehending how hot water heater attach to both the cold water supply and warm water distribution lines helps in detecting problems like inadequate hot water or leaks.

Maintenance Tips for Water Heaters


Frequently flushing your water heater to get rid of debris, examining the temperature setups, and evaluating for leakages can expand its life expectancy and boost power performance.

Usual Pipes Problems


Leaks and Their Reasons


Leakages can occur because of aging pipes, loose installations, or high water stress. Dealing with leaks immediately avoids water damage and mold and mildew development.

Blockages and Blockages


Obstructions in drains pipes and toilets are frequently caused by purging non-flushable things or an accumulation of grease and hair. Making use of drain screens and bearing in mind what goes down your drains pipes can stop obstructions.

Indications of Pipes Issues to Watch For


Low tide pressure, slow-moving drains, foul odors, or abnormally high water bills are indicators of prospective pipes issues that should be resolved immediately.

Main Building Codes


The plumbing system layout for a home must adhere to all applicable local construction requirements. The number of fixtures permitted on a given drain system, vent stack, the location of supply drains, and lines are all specified by the relevant building regulations.


It is important to have a well-designed plumbing system that complies with all applicable regulations. It is built with meticulous attention to detail so that it may pass muster during building inspections and adhere to all applicable rules and regulations.


Draft Of Supply


These blueprints calculate the approximate lengths and placements of hot and cold water supply lines. The package includes a variety of blueprints, as well as details on water, drain, and vent lines, as well as installation guidelines, legends, and explanatory comments.


Still, the plans don't always account for the fact that the pipes' precise placement may depend on the specifics of each building. Fixture placement, dimensions, the minimum height from the floor, distance from the wall, symbols, and other information are typically included in rough-in plumbing.


Gas Piping


Natural gas and propane appliances may be installed in nearly all homes. Fuel for the stove, oven, furnace, etc., is piped through iron, polyethylene, and steel pipes. Lines are combined using threaded fittings that screw together and are sealed at the joint the seal functions as a protective barrier to keep harmful substances out.


Heightening of the DWV


The system that transports the wastewater and air out of the home is called a Drain-Waste-Vent elevation, or DWV for short. This section addresses the direction that exhaust vents, drain pipes, and traps in plumbing fixtures all point upward. Primarily, it demonstrates how various fixtures' airflow will work. Pipes of the Appropriate Dimensions


Pipes must be properly sized to prevent future obstructions and costly repairs. Undersized pipes will prevent the system from working properly and will not fulfill plumbing standards.


Inadequate water pressure from the pipes or inconsistent water temperatures between fixture models is possible issues. Similarly crucial is selecting an appropriate pipe type. PVC pipes are widely used, but they break easily and must be replaced more often than stronger materials like copper or PEX after they're installed in a home.


The efficiency of the plumbing system and the reduction in future maintenance efforts are directly related to the material and size of the pipes.
